The term Generic Traveller is one used at the Traveller RPG Wiki to describe publications and products produced for Traveller, but not targeted for a specific Version of Traveller, rules set, or setting. The Ludography attempts to assign a specific Traveller rules version to each publication but, as with all categorization systems, there are some exceptions.

The Wiki editorial team applies Generic Traveller version to

  • Publications containing only general background information and no specific rules, which allow a Referee to insert this into any campaign.
  • Publications containing rules which expand or replace the existing Traveller rules. In many cases these can be used without Traveller, but these are targeted to Traveller Players and Referees.
  • Publications designed for non-Traveller game systems, but similar to the above, can expand or replace the existing Traveller rules and background.
  • Periodicals generally devoted to the broader gaming market, including other gaming systems, which have some non-canon Traveller content.
  • Publications released without the license or approval of the (at the time) Traveller publisher. These are usually published for "any science fiction game", but include directions for use with Traveller.
